Hartford HealthCare, K Health Partner to Launch AI-Powered Virtual Primary Care Platform

What You Should Know: 

– Hartford HealthCare (HHC), a healthcare system in Connecticut, and K Health, a digital healthcare company specializing in AI-powered primary care, today announced a partnership to launch HHC 24/7, a new virtual health platform. 

– The collaboration aims to transform primary care access and delivery for patients across Connecticut.

HHC 24/7 to Provide Convenient, Accessible Care to Connecticut Communities

HHC 24/7, powered by K Health’s advanced clinical AI, will provide patients with convenient and personalized primary care services anytime, anywhere. The platform offers:

  • 24/7 access to care: Patients can connect with healthcare providers around the clock, eliminating the need to wait for appointments or travel to a clinic.
  • Comprehensive primary care: HHC 24/7 offers a wide range of services, including diagnosis and treatment of acute illnesses, management of chronic conditions, and preventive care.
  • Personalized care: K Health’s AI technology tailors treatment plans to each patient’s individual needs and preferences.
  • Seamless integration: HHC 24/7 integrates with Hartford HealthCare’s existing systems, ensuring continuity of care and coordinated care across the health system.

“I couldn’t be prouder of what we are achieving together. This is about world-class care and ensuring everyone has access to the best care available. Our partnership with K Health helps make this happen,” said Jeffrey A. Flaks, President & CEO of Hartford HealthCare.
